Job Description
The Cafeteria Cook will accurately and efficiently prepare, portion, cook, and present a variety of hot and/or cold food items for various meal periods: to include Breakfast, Lunch, and Special/Catered Events. The general responsibilities of the position include those listed below, but Sodexo may identify other responsibilities of the position.
General Responsibilities:
- Prepares and cooks to order foods requiring short and broader preparation time utilizing professional equipment.
- Follows basic recipes and/or product directions for preparing, seasoning, cooking, tasting, carving and serving soups, meats, vegetables, desserts and other foodstuffs for consumption in eating establishments.
- Tastes products, reads menus, estimates food requirements, checks production, and keeps records in order to accurately plan production requirements and requisition supplies and equipment.
- Places food ordering and keeps inventory.
- Clean and sanitize work stations and equipment and must follow all Sodexo, client and regulatory rules and procedures.
- May select recipes per menu cycle, prepare bakery items, receive inventory, move and lift foodstuffs and supplies and prepare meals for customers requiring special diets.
- Participates in regular safety meetings, safety training and hazard assessments.
- May perform other duties and responsibilities as assigned
